Facility Evaluation Report
On September 17, 2025, Licensing Program Analyst (LPA) Jenifer Tirre conducted an unannounced required visit using the CARE Inspection Tool. LPA was greeted by staff and granted entry after stating the purpose of the visit. Administrator Teresita Lozano arrived shortly after and was available to assist with the facility inspection.
The facility is licensed for six (6) non-ambulatory Residents with approved Hospice waiver for two. Currently, there is Five (5) Residents present during today’s visit. During today’s visit there was zero (0) residents on hospice.
This is a single story with detached garage facility. The facility has six bedrooms (five resident rooms and one staff room), four restrooms, living room, dining room, kitchen and three bathrooms.
At around 1:15PM, LPA conducted a tour of the physical plant accompanied by Caregiver, and the following was observed: Facility has pool in backyard with a secured gate. All rooms were inspected. Beds and bedding supplies were in operational condition, lighting was provided, and storage for resident’s personal belongings was observed. Bed linens, blankets and bath towels were available during the visit. Bathrooms were operational with water temperature measured at 107.9 to 114.6 degrees F.
LPA observed the facility to be furnished at the time of the visit. Storage areas for cleaning supplies and sharps objects were stored and not accessible to residents. The kitchen was inspected, and facility has two day perishables and seven day non-perishable food. Facility has supply of emergency food and water. Facility has one fire extinguisher which was charged. CONTINUED ON 809C
